What role did Afshan Azad-Kazi play in the 'Harry Potter' films?

Afshan Azad-Kazi played the role of Padma Patil, a Ravenclaw student who was also a friend of Parvati Patil.

What is Afshan Azad-Kazi doing now?

Afshan Azad-Kazi is actively pursuing her acting career and is now a mother, enjoying this new chapter in her life.

Did Afshan Azad-Kazi continue acting after 'Harry Potter'?

Yes, she has continued acting, taking on various roles in television and theater, demonstrating her dedication to the craft.

How many children does Afshan Azad-Kazi have?

Afshan Azad-Kazi has one child, a baby boy.

Did Afshan Azad-Kazi attend the 'Harry Potter' reunions?

Yes, she was part of the 'Harry Potter 20th Anniversary: Return to Hogwarts' reunion special, reuniting with her castmates and sharing her memories.
